Exam 98-362: Windows Development Fundamentals/Creating Windows Services Applications
This lesson covers Creating Windows Services Applications. It looks at creating and installing Windows Services applications.
Activity 1 - Create a Windows Services Application
This objective may include but is not limited to: inheriting the ServiceBase class; writing code in the Main method; overriding the OnStart and OnStop procedures.
Activity 2 - Install a Windows Services Application
This objective may include but is not limited to: creating installers for Windows Services; installing services on a target computer.
